Chicago, IL. - November 25, 2007 - FUJIFILM Medical Systems USA, Inc., the dominant worldwide leader in Full Field Digital Mammography (FFDM) installations with more than 4,000 Fuji Computed Radiography for Mammography (FCRm) readers installed around the globe, is pleased to announce another record sales quarter. FCRm is uniquely scalable and flexible in its design, enabling Fujifilm to meet the individual FFDM needs of any breast screening facility, regardless of size or image management requirements.

For breast imaging facilities looking to implement FFDM, Fujifilm - with two FCRm image reader options - is unique in its ability to deliver FFDM to accommodate any workflow and throughput needs, while still delivering the company's renowned image quality. And when needs go beyond the acquisition modality, combining FCRm with Fujifilm's industry-leading SynapseŽ PACS assures delivery of an acquisition-to-archive solution which is easily scaled to address the requirements of a large IDN with multiple sites, a single screening room at a small imaging center, or any size facility in between.

Fujifilm continues to demonstrate its leadership in FFDM and is the fastest growing digital mammography solution in the U.S. From coast to coast, facilities of all sizes continue to implement FCRm, with users reinforcing its viability.

St. Francis Hospital and Medical Center, Hartford, CT

617 bed tertiary, general acute care hospital.
Comprehensive Breast Center with 4 mammography exam rooms, 12,000 annual mammography exams.

"A long time Fujifilm digital x-ray and Synapse PACS customer, we are well aware of the company's history of delivering quality imaging and continued product innovation. So FCRm was the clear FFDM choice for us. Not only does FCRm deliver confidence with Fujifilm's high quality diagnostic images, but it fit seamlessly into our existing digital environment providing a cost-effective, end-to-end FFDM solution."

Len Quartararo, M.S., RT(R) (N), Director of Radiology and Imaging Services

Greenville Hospital System, Greenville, NC

5-Campus, 1110-bed IDN.
25,000 screening mammograms annually at main women's center and satellite facilities

"Having several facilities each with a unique set of requirements, we needed an FFDM solution that would enable us to simultaneously transition each screening room from analog to digital. Fujifilm was the only digital mammography provider that could assure us a high quality, completely configurable economic solution. We couldn't be more pleased with FCRm and our ability to offer all patients the benefits of digital."

A. Scopteuolo, MD

Pacific Breast Center, Beaverton, OR

Multi-room screening center with more than 16,000 annual mammograms

"Fujifilm CR for Mammography was clearly the logical choice for FFDM. It not only gave us the greatest flexibility in converting our office and satellites, but we now offer patients the highest resolution digital mammography of any breast imaging service in the area. Additionally, a very important benefit of FCRm is its ability to use either the large or small image receptor, which we consider essential for optimal mammographic positioning."

G. W. Eklund, MD, FACR, Medical Director

About FUJIFILM Medical Systems USA, Inc.
As one of the FUJIFILM Corporation family of companies with 70 years of imaging experience and almost $25 billion in sales, FUJIFILM Medical Systems USA Inc. is a leading provider of diagnostic imaging products and network systems to meet the needs of healthcare facilities today and well into the future. Fujifilm's family of Imaging Systems products and technologies-including digital x-ray, women's healthcare imaging, dry imagers, and conventional x-ray film and equipment-are tailored to suit many different applications for a variety of imaging environments. Fuji Computed Radiography for Mammography (FCRm) has long been the world's most widely used Full Field Digital Mammography (FFDM) solution, and is already making a notable impact on the FFDM market in the United States since receiving FDA approval. FUJIFILM Medical Systems USA is headquartered in Stamford, CT.
